Embroidered laces sometimes use a tulle backing, onto which a decorative pattern is utilized using needle and thread to form the looks of an applique. This can then be further embroidered, if required, by including beading, sequins and cording. Embroidered lace items on a separate tulle layer create depth and dimension. Sometimes known as the "queen of lace," Alencon Lace is a fine needlepoint lace often discovered with a floral design on a sheer or internet again and generally features beadwork. A Japanese marriage ceremony normally includes a traditional pure white kimono for the formal ceremony, symbolizing purity and maidenhood. The bride may change right into a purple kimono for the occasions after the ceremony for good luck. So known as because it might possibly barely be seen towards your physique, phantasm necklines have surged in reputation lately as a versatile, stylish possibility. Illusion necklines are usually made from sheer cloth like tulle or lace that always extends near your neck.
